Morecambe is a charming coastal town located in Lancashire, northwest England, renowned for its stunning bay views, Victorian architectural heritage, and picturesque seafront.

Situated along the Irish Sea, this historic seaside destination offers visitors a unique blend of natural beauty, cultural attractions, and nostalgic maritime charm.

The Morecambe Hotel enjoys an exceptional location directly overlooking Morecambe Bay, providing guests with bre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ding landscape.

Transportation accessibility is comprehensive, with Lancaster Railway Station located approximately 4 miles away, offering connections to major cities.

Local bus services operate extensively throughout the region, ensuring convenient urban and regional mobility.

Educational institutions in the vicinity include Lancaster University, a prestigious research-driven institution located nearby.

The University of Cumbria's Lancaster Campus provides additional higher education opportunities.

These academic establishments contribute significantly to the region's intellectual and research environments.

Historical attractions are remarkably diverse.

The iconic Eric Morecambe Statue represents the town's connection to the famous comedian.

The Midland Hotel, a stunning Art Deco architectural landmark, symbolizes the area's architectural heritage.

The Lancaster City Museum and the maritime-focused Maritime Museum offer comprehensive historical insights into the region's cultural development.

Description :
The MORECAMBE HOTEL has a great restaurant and is a beautifully refurbished 1828 former coaching inn. We have 7 luxury en suite bed and breakfast guest rooms.
